Boris Karavanov gallery

Boris Karavanov was born in 1950 near Minsk, USSR. Graduated as an artist and architect from Minsk Academy of Fine Arts. Studied painting in the Workshop of Prof. Baranovsky. Taught architecture and drawing at Minsk Academy of Fine Arts and painting in the Minsk Art College. Immigrated to Israel in 1994. Member of Artists' Association in the Republic of Belarus (1994). Member of Painters and Sculptors Association in Israel (1998).

Boris Karavanov:
"Neither genre, nor plot is of any special importance. One can paint a perfect still life with apples and an appalling nude. For me the most significant question in art is, "How?"

Solo exhibitions of the last years:
  • 1996: Matusevich Gallery, Tel-Aviv, Israel
  • 1996: Beit Daniel, Tel-Aviv, Israel
  • 1997: Beit Canada, Ramat-Gan, Israel
  • 1998: The Fine Arts' Center, Rishon-Le-Zion, Israel
  • 1999: Beit Daniel, Tel-Aviv, Israel
  • 2002: Beit Yad le-Banim, Tel-Aviv, Israel
  • 2003: Eshkol ha-Pais, Ariel, Israel
  • 2003: "Tzavta" Theatre, Tel-Aviv, Israel
